Whenever possible, private detective John Jones preferred to eat at one of the Dairy Queens of Denver, Colorado.  Certainly, there were places with better food and at times he ate there, but he always returned to the land of frozen treats and for one simple reason: Choco Blizzards.  Earth would never be Mars, he had long ago accepted that, but new delights such as Chocos went a quite a ways toward making up for it.

The Blizzard, the day to day habits of his civilian identity, burying himself in work, went a long way to toward taking his mind off many things which troubled him.  That the League had disbanded was high among them.  The League had been a part of his life ever since he had participated in its formation.  Others had come and gone, but always he had remained.  He could have protested the disbandment, could even have remained and rebuilt anew, but no.  Something vital, something important to the League had been lost, broken.  These wounds would take time to heal.

How much things had changed since the old days.  They had all been quite happy, friends, sure of themselves and their powers,  sure that the path they were on was the right one.  And now?

Barry and Hal were dead.   Arthur and Bruce were barely recognizable as the men he had once known.  Even Diana was different from the new visitor to Man's World she had been when she had first met them all.  Clark remained largely the same, he supposed, if perhaps even more settled into his role as a leader in the super-human community.

But J'onn?  J'onn had been on Earth since the mid 1950's, long before most of the current generation of heroes had even been born.  He had been brought to Earth as an adult, not an infant like Clark.  He had new friends, new connections on this planet, but he was still much the same he had been.

An overwhelming moment of panic set upon his senses, the telepathic nosie of numerous citizens all crying out at once.  A glance up instantly told him what was the cause.  A meteor, hurling toward the city, already too close for him to do anything about it.  It had to be alien in nature, advanced.  This was no natural phenomena.  

What he could do was help people.  Turning invisible and resuming his public Martian form, he pulled people from the path of the meteor at high speed, moments before the meteor hit.

Where have I seen this before...?

The meteor impacted with the street, hard, but not with the speed it should have had.  It was as though it had slowed itself.  It cracked and something inside it began to grow...  and burn.

It was a giant of fire.
